ORDER

The petitioner claims to be an agriculturist and according to him, he is entitled to get subsidy for irrigation purpose and he already made an application to the District Backward and Minority Welfare Officer, Theni/third respondent herein, who in turn, by the proceedings in Na.Ka.No.48982/10/j5 dated 17.08.2010, sent a https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

recommendation to the Managing Director, Tamil Nadu Backward Economic Development Corporation, Chennai to grant subsidy to the tune of Rs.50,000/- to the petitioner. Despite the recommendation made by the third respondent, no order has been passed so far by the respondents. Hence, the petitioner is before this Court by filing the present writ petition.

2.Heard the learned counsel appearing for the petitioner, the learned Special Government Pleader for the first respondent and the learned Standing Counsel for the second respondent and perused the records carefully.

3.From a perusal of the records, it could be seen that the the District Backward and Minority Welfare Officer, Theni has sent a recommendation to the Managing Director, Tamil Nadu Backward Economic Development Corporation, Chennai to grant subsidy to the petitioner, which is pending before him. In the above circumstances, this Court directs the Managing Director, Tamil Nadu Backward Economic Development Corporation, Chennai/fourth respondent herein to consider the recommendation sent by the third respondent and pass appropriate orders on merits and in accordance with law within a period of six we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

4.With the above direction, this writ petition is disposed of. No costs.
